Bug Description

Bug Description:
The css in win7 IE8 seems to be all over the place. On the login screen everything is transposed to the left bug 583830 and once logged in it is either transposed left or right.

OS:
32bit WIN7 starter

Browser:
IE 8.0.7600.16385

Problem URL:
https://login.staging.ubuntu.com (logged in)

Steps To Reproduce:
1. Goto https://login.staging.ubuntu.com and login
2. View as things move left or right of the screen rather than being centralised.

Expected Result:
Everything should be nicely centred as it is in all other browsers.
